Use Cases
Aerospace Engineering
Wind tunnel simulation is widely used in aerospace engineering to test aircraft and engine aerodynamics. It helps in measuring lift and drag forces, understanding fluid movement around models, and improving designs for better performance.
Automotive Engineering
In the automotive industry, wind tunnel testing helps gather data on aerodynamic forces, drag, lift, side force, and moments. It aids in improving vehicle designs for better performance and fuel efficiency.
Building and Construction
Wind tunnel testing is important for evaluating the structural integrity and comfort of buildings. It helps in understanding wind loads and vibrations, ensuring safety and comfort in urban environments.
